有了云服务器还需要docker吗苹果,云服务器与Docker,相辅相成,构建高效运维体系
- 综合资讯
- 2024-12-07 09:10:39
- 1

云服务器与Docker结合使用,可构建更高效运维体系。两者相辅相成,实现资源优化配置和快速部署。...
云服务器与Docker结合使用,可构建更高效运维体系。两者相辅相成,实现资源优化配置和快速部署。
随着云计算技术的不断发展,云服务器已经成为企业运维的重要工具,在拥有云服务器的同时,是否还需要引入Docker技术呢?本文将从多个角度分析云服务器与Docker的关系,帮助您更好地理解二者在运维体系中的作用。
云服务器与Docker的定义
1、云服务器:云服务器是指通过云计算技术,将物理服务器虚拟化,以虚拟机(VM)的形式提供给用户使用的服务,用户可以按需购买、配置和扩展资源,实现弹性伸缩。
2、Docker:Docker是一种开源的应用容器引擎,可以将应用程序及其依赖环境打包成一个标准化的容器,通过Docker,用户可以实现快速部署、迁移和扩展应用程序。
云服务器与Docker的关系
1、云服务器是基础,Docker是补充
云服务器提供了虚拟化、弹性伸缩等基础功能,而Docker则是在此基础上,进一步优化应用程序的部署、管理和扩展,可以说,云服务器是Docker的基础,而Docker则是云服务器功能的补充。
2、云服务器与Docker优势互补
(1)云服务器:提供弹性伸缩、负载均衡、高可用性等基础功能,降低运维成本。
(2)Docker:简化应用程序的部署、迁移和扩展,提高开发效率。
3、二者结合,构建高效运维体系
将云服务器与Docker结合,可以构建一个高效、可扩展的运维体系,具体体现在以下几个方面:
(1)快速部署:通过Docker,可以将应用程序及其依赖环境打包成一个标准化的容器,实现快速部署。
(2)简化迁移:Docker容器具有可移植性,可以轻松地在不同云服务器之间迁移。
(3)弹性伸缩:结合云服务器的弹性伸缩功能,可以根据业务需求,动态调整容器数量。
(4)高可用性:通过Docker容器集群和云服务器的高可用性设计,确保应用程序的稳定运行。
云服务器与Docker的适用场景
1、云服务器适用场景
(1)需要弹性伸缩的业务场景:如电商、在线教育等。
(2)需要高可用性的业务场景:如金融、政务等。
2、Docker适用场景
(1)需要快速部署、迁移和扩展的应用程序。
(2)需要隔离应用程序及其依赖环境的场景。
云服务器与Docker相辅相成,共同构建高效运维体系,云服务器提供基础功能,而Docker则在此基础上,进一步优化应用程序的部署、管理和扩展,在拥有云服务器的同时,引入Docker技术,将有助于提升企业运维效率,降低成本。
本文链接:https://zhitaoyun.cn/1383468.html
发表评论